Probleme avec pipe

rlebik6 Messages postés 4 Date d'inscription vendredi 19 décembre 2003 Statut Membre Dernière intervention 11 mars 2011 - 11 mars 2011 à 03:54
rlebik6 Messages postés 4 Date d'inscription vendredi 19 décembre 2003 Statut Membre Dernière intervention 11 mars 2011 - 11 mars 2011 à 06:06
Bonjour a tous
j'aimerai faire un tri sur /etc/passwd selon le premier champ, mettre le resultat dans tmp, transferer ce resultat a la commande cut qui ne conservera que le premier champ, ecire ce resultat dans tmp2 du meme coup envoyer ce nouveau resultat a grep qui cherchera les lignes debutant par "s" et qui placera ces lignes dans un fichier tmp3... tout ca en 1 seule commande...
j'ai effectue la commande suivante (mais elle ne marche pas): $ sort -k1,2 /etc/passwd > tmp |cut -c1 > tmp2 | grep -i "^s" > tmp3

aidez moi s'il vous plait

1 réponse

rlebik6 Messages postés 4 Date d'inscription vendredi 19 décembre 2003 Statut Membre Dernière intervention 11 mars 2011
11 mars 2011 à 06:06
je viens de trouver la commande est:

$ sort -k1,2 /etc/passwd | tee tmp | cut -c1 | tee tmp2 | grep -i "^s" > tmp3
0
Rejoignez-nous